How to Secure Your WordPress Website from Cyber Threats

How to Secure Your WordPress Website from Cyber Threats

How to Secure Your WordPress Website from Cyber Threats

Secure your WordPress website from cyber threats by implementing robust security measures, regularly updating plugins and themes, and educating users on best practices to mitigate potential risks effectively. WordPress powers a significant portion of websites on the internet today, making it a prime target for cybercriminals. Securing your WordPress website is crucial to protect sensitive data, maintain site availability, and safeguard your reputation. This comprehensive guide explores effective strategies, best practices, and tools to enhance the security of your WordPress website against cyber threats.

Understanding WordPress Security

Common Threats

  1. Brute Force Attacks: Automated attempts to guess usernames and passwords to gain unauthorized access.

  2. Malware Infections: Malicious software designed to compromise website security, steal data, or disrupt operations.

  3. Phishing: Deceptive tactics to trick users into revealing sensitive information such as login credentials.

  4. Outdated Software: Vulnerabilities in outdated WordPress core, themes, and plugins that can be exploited by attackers.

Importance of WordPress Security

  • Data Protection: Safeguard sensitive information, including user data and payment details.

  • Website Availability: Prevent downtime and maintain continuous access to your website.

  • Business Reputation: Protect your brand’s reputation and trustworthiness among users and customers.

Essential Steps to Secure Your WordPress Website

1. Keep WordPress Core, Themes, and Plugins Updated

Regularly update WordPress core, themes, and plugins to patch security vulnerabilities and ensure compatibility with the latest security standards. Enable automatic updates for critical updates to minimize the risk of exploitation.

2. Use Strong and Unique Passwords

Employ complex passwords for all user accounts, including administrators, editors, and contributors. Avoid using easily guessable passwords and consider using a password manager to generate and store strong passwords securely.

3. Implement Two-Factor Authentication (2FA)

Enable two-factor authentication for WordPress login to add an extra layer of security. 2FA requires users to verify their identity using a second factor, such as a mobile device or email, in addition to their password.

4. Use Secure Hosting and Server Configuration

Choose a reputable hosting provider that offers robust security features, such as firewalls, malware scanning, and regular backups. Implement secure server configurations, including HTTPS encryption, to protect data transmitted between users and your website.

5. Install Security Plugins

WordPress security plugins provide additional layers of protection by monitoring for suspicious activity, scanning for malware, and implementing firewall rules to block malicious traffic. Popular security plugins include Wordfence, Sucuri Security, and iThemes Security.

6. Limit Login Attempts and Admin Access

Use plugins or server configurations to limit the number of login attempts allowed within a specified timeframe. Restrict access to the WordPress admin dashboard and sensitive files by IP address or using VPNs for remote access.

7. Regularly Backup Your Website

Perform regular backups of your WordPress website to ensure that you can restore functionality in case of a security incident or data loss. Store backups securely offsite or use a reliable backup service provided by your hosting provider.

8. Harden WordPress Security Settings

Configure WordPress security settings to enhance protection against common threats. This includes disabling file editing from the WordPress dashboard, restricting XML-RPC access, and implementing security headers such as Content Security Policy (CSP) and X-Frame-Options.

9. Monitor and Audit User Activity

Monitor user activity logs to detect suspicious behavior, such as multiple failed login attempts or unauthorized file modifications. Conduct regular security audits to identify vulnerabilities and ensure compliance with security best practices.

10. Educate Users on Security Best Practices

Educate website administrators, editors, and contributors on security best practices, including phishing awareness, password hygiene, and recognizing suspicious emails or links. Promote a culture of security awareness among all users with access to your WordPress website.

Advanced WordPress Security Measures about How to Secure Your WordPress Website from Cyber Threats

Advanced WordPress Security Measures

1. Web Application Firewall (WAF)

Deploy a web application firewall to filter and monitor HTTP traffic to your WordPress website. WAFs protect against common attacks, such as SQL injection, cross-site scripting (XSS), and distributed denial-of-service (DDoS) attacks, before they reach your server.

2. Malware Scanning and Removal

Regularly scan your WordPress website for malware using security plugins or online scanning tools. Immediately remove any identified malware to prevent it from compromising your website’s security and reputation.

3. Vulnerability Assessments and Penetration Testing

Conduct vulnerability assessments and penetration testing (pen testing) to identify and remediate security weaknesses in your WordPress website. Hire professional security experts or use automated tools to simulate real-world attack scenarios and strengthen your defenses.

4. Secure Development Practices

Adopt secure coding practices when developing or customizing WordPress themes and plugins. Follow WordPress coding standards, sanitize user input, and regularly review and update your codebase to mitigate potential vulnerabilities.

5. Disaster Recovery Plan

Develop and maintain a comprehensive disaster recovery plan outlining procedures to restore your WordPress website in the event of a security breach, data loss, or other emergencies. Test your disaster recovery plan periodically to ensure readiness and effectiveness.

Best Practices for WordPress Security

1. Regularly Audit and Update Security Policies

Review and update your WordPress security policies, including access control, data protection, and incident response procedures. Ensure that all stakeholders are aware of and adhere to these policies to maintain a secure environment.

2. Stay Informed About Security Threats

Stay informed about the latest security threats and vulnerabilities affecting WordPress websites. Subscribe to security bulletins, follow reputable security blogs and forums, and participate in community discussions to stay ahead of emerging threats.

3. Implement Security Headers and HTTPS

Configure security headers, such as HTTP Strict Transport Security (HSTS) and X-XSS-Protection, to enhance browser security and protect against common web vulnerabilities. Use HTTPS encryption to secure data transmission between users and your WordPress website.

4. Conduct Regular Security Audits

Perform regular security audits of your WordPress website to identify and address security weaknesses proactively. Test for vulnerabilities, review access logs, and audit user permissions to maintain a secure and compliant environment.

Case Studies and Examples

1. HealthCare.gov

HealthCare.gov, the official health insurance marketplace in the United States, experienced a significant security breach in 2013 due to vulnerabilities in its WordPress-based content management system. The incident underscored the importance of robust security measures and prompted extensive security improvements.

2. WP White Security

WP White Security, a leading provider of WordPress security plugins and services, emphasizes the importance of continuous monitoring, auditing, and proactive security measures to protect WordPress websites against evolving cyber threats.

Conclusion

Securing your WordPress website from cyber threats requires a proactive and multifaceted approach that encompasses robust security practices, regular updates, and user education. By implementing the strategies and best practices outlined in this guide, you can significantly enhance the security posture of your WordPress website and mitigate the risk of data breaches, downtime, and reputational damage. Remember that effective WordPress security is an ongoing effort that requires vigilance, awareness of emerging threats, and a commitment to safeguarding sensitive information and maintaining the trust of your website visitors and customers. With a solid foundation in WordPress security, you can confidently operate your website and focus on achieving your business goals in a secure online environment.

Picture of Emmanuel

Emmanuel

Full Stack WordPress & SEO
Author

My name is Emmanuel, the proud owner and founder of Websprove.com, specializing in professional website development and WordPress services. With a solid background in WordPress development and a Bachelor’s degree in BSIT from the Philippines, I bring over a decade of experience as a senior-level WordPress developer.

Having successfully collaborated with clients from US, Australia & Canada, I am now seeking a stable and growth-oriented company where I can contribute my skills and continue expanding my expertise. I firmly believe that my extensive experience and knowledge make me an invaluable asset to your esteemed team.

Share this post